We know for a fact as well that too much of that one specific food type, like sweets and sodium-rich … grandma telling stories to kids clipartWebChocolate contains caffeine, a stimulant that can temporarily raise blood pressure. If you already have high blood pressure, the caffeine in chocolate is likely to raise your blood pressure to a greater degree than if you have normal blood pressure. A 3.5-oz. chocolate bar has 86 mg of caffeine, according to the U.S. Department of Agriculture. grandma telling storyWebFeb 14, 2024 · Fluctuating blood pressure can be caused by several issues.
